mijan24 Posted June 16, 2003 Share Posted June 16, 2003 A friend here in Aust intends visiting Thailand for 21 days and has asked if he requires a tourist visa? He has been advised by the Thai Consulate in Sydney that since Sept 11 visa processing now takes min 3 days he leaves Sydney Thur 19 Jun. To the best of my knowledge he does not require a visa, is this correct and is there anything he should know when passing through Don Muang (with respect to non visa requirement). His return ticket has him departing July 14th (hence only 3 week stay). ???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Brian Posted June 16, 2003 Share Posted June 16, 2003 Assuming that your friend holds an Australian passport... No need to get a visa first. Just turn up at Don Muang and he'll be issued with 30 day visa.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
mijan24 Posted June 16, 2003 Author Share Posted June 16, 2003 Brian - yes he has Aust passport. Thanks, is there a cost involved and waiting time frame at DM. Regards Mijan24 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
dr_Pat_Pong Posted June 16, 2003 Share Posted June 16, 2003 No fee is payable and the process is done quickly at the Immigration counteron arrival.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
